html, body {
	background: url(./images/fondo.gif) repeat-y center;
	margin: 0px;
}

#bigbordo {
	border: 2px #ffffff solid;
}


.bordo {
	border-left: 1px #ffffff solid;
	border-bottom: 1px #ffffff solid;
}

.bordonews {
	border: 1px #C6171F solid;
}

.titolo {
	padding: 5px 10px 5px 10px;
	font-family: Arial Narrow, sans-serif;
	font-size: 14px;
	font-weight: normal;
	color: #1F496D;
	background: url(./images/cyandot.gif) repeat-x bottom;
}


p {
	padding: 0px 10px 20px 10px;
	font-family: Gill Sans MT, Arial, Verdana,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	background: url(./images/tratdot.gif) repeat-x bottom;
	}
p a { 
	text-decoration: none;
	color: #999999;
	}
p a:hover { 
	color: #C6171F;
	}

/*------------------------ TABELLA ------------------------*/
.titolotab {
	padding: 5px 0px 5px 10px;
	font-family: Arial Narrow, sans-serif;
	font-size: 14px;
	font-weight: normal;
	color: #1F496D;
}



.cella {
	padding: 0px 0px 4px 10px;
	font-family: Gill Sans MT, Arial, Verdana,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	background: url(./images/tratdot.gif) repeat-x bottom;
	}
.cella a { 
	text-decoration: none;
	color: #999999;
	}
.cella a:hover { 
	color: #C6171F;
	}



/*------------------------ B A R R A - S E R V I Z I ------------------------*/

.servizio {
	border-left: 1px #ffffff solid;
	border-bottom: 1px #ffffff solid;
	margin: 0px;
	padding: 0px 20px 0px 20px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	color: #666666;
	}

.servizio a { 
	text-decoration: none;
	color: #666666;
	}
.servizio a:hover { 
	text-decoration: underline;
	}

